Bermagui Accommodation – Stay by the Sea with Reflections

When you’re searching for Bermagui accommodation, you’re usually looking for somewhere that puts you close to the water, the town and the natural beauty this part of the NSW South Coast is known for.

At Reflections Holidays Bermagui, our roofed accommodation options are designed to suit a wide range of stays, from relaxed couples’ escapes through to family holidays, group trips and dog-friendly breaks by the coast.

With 11 roofed accommodation options to choose from, staying with us means you can base yourself right near Bermagui’s beaches, harbour and coastal walking tracks, while choosing a stay that fits how you travel. Whether you’re here for a short coastal break or a longer stay by the sea, our Bermagui accommodation makes it easy to slow down and enjoy the setting.

Choosing the right Bermagui accommodation for your stay

Everyone comes to Bermagui for a slightly different reason. Some guests want a quiet couple of nights by the water, others are travelling with family or friends, and many want to bring the dog along too. Our accommodation is designed around those different trip styles, making it easier to find the right option without overthinking it.

Couples, solo stays and compact coastal escapes

If you’re travelling without kids or planning a low-key coastal getaway, our smaller accommodation options are a great fit. These stays suit couples or solo travellers who want comfort, privacy and easy access to Bermagui’s beaches, harbour and cafés.

The Superior Cabin Sleeps 2 offers a comfortable, well-appointed space that works perfectly for short stays and relaxed weekends away. If you’re travelling with your dog or need accessible features, the Superior Cabin Sleeps 2 – Dog Friendly & Accessible delivers the same ease and comfort with added flexibility.

For couples looking for something more contemporary, the Premium Tiny Home Sleeps 2 offers a compact, modern stay with smart design and a strong connection to the outdoors. It’s ideal if you enjoy minimalist spaces and spending most of your time exploring the coastline rather than staying indoors.

Family-friendly cabins with room to move

Bermagui is a favourite for family holidays, and many of our cabins are designed to make family stays easy and comfortable. These options offer practical layouts, generous sleeping arrangements and space to relax after days spent swimming, fishing or walking the coastal tracks.

The Superior Cabin Sleeps 6 is a solid choice for families who want a comfortable base close to everything Bermagui has to offer. For a step up in comfort and space, the Premium Cabin Sleeps 4 and Premium Cabin Sleeps 6 provide well-designed interiors suited to longer stays and busier holiday periods.

If you’re travelling with a mixed group or need additional accessibility features, the Premium Cabin Sleeps 5 – Accessible is designed to support a comfortable, inclusive stay without compromising on location or quality.

Premium stays and ocean-view accommodation

If your Bermagui getaway is about slowing down and making the most of the coastal setting, our premium accommodation options are designed to elevate the experience. These stays offer more space, thoughtful layouts and, in some cases, ocean views that make it easy to settle in and unwind.

The Premium Cabin Ocean View Sleeps 4 is ideal if waking up near the water is a priority. For larger families or groups who want premium comfort, the Premium Cabin 3 Bedroom Sleeps 6 offers generous living areas that work well for shared holidays and longer stays.

Dog-friendly accommodation at Bermagui

Bermagui is a great destination for holidays with your dog, and we offer several dog-friendly accommodation options so everyone can come along for the trip.

The Standard Cabin Sleeps 6 – Dog Friendly is a popular choice for families and groups travelling with pets, offering space and convenience in a relaxed setting. For couples or solo travellers, the Superior Cabin Sleeps 2 – Dog Friendly & Accessible combines compact comfort with pet-friendly flexibility.

If you’re travelling as a larger group with your dog, the Superior Villa Sleeps 6 – Dog Friendly provides extra room to spread out while keeping everyone together under one roof.

Dog-friendly accommodation is always in high demand, especially during peak periods, so we recommend booking early if you’re planning to bring your dog along.

Why stay with us at Bermagui?

Staying at Reflections Holidays Bermagui means you’re perfectly placed to enjoy everything this coastal town has to offer. Start the day with a walk along the beach or around the harbour, spend your afternoons swimming, fishing or exploring nearby coastal trails, and finish with an easy dinner in town or back at your accommodation.

Our Bermagui accommodation options are designed to support that laid-back coastal rhythm. You’re close to the water and the heart of town, but still have your own space to unwind at the end of the day.

What time is check-in/check-out at Bermagui Caravan Park?

Check in for both powered and unpowered sites at Bermagui Holiday Park is from 11am, whilst cabins allow check in from 3pm onwards.

If you plan to arrive after office hours (9am –5pm) please let us know so that we can have all relevant documents waiting for your arrival.

Checkout from both sites and cabins is 10am.


What should I bring for my stay?

Preparing for a holiday can be a massive journey in itself. At Reflections Bermagui Holiday and Caravan Park, our aim is to ensure guests are as well-equipped as possible before hitting the open road.

If you’re planning a stay in one of our cabins or beach tents, we have many of the essentials covered, with linen, towels and kitchenware all provided. All you’ll need is some delicious treats, comfy clothes, good company and a thirst for adventure.

For guests pitching a tent on our campsites or setting up shop in your caravans or camper trailers, Reflections Bermagui has a well-equipped camp kitchen. We also recommend packing a torch and spare batteries, your trusty first aid kit, plenty of insect repellent, sunscreen and hats to keep you sun-safe, and rubbish bags to keep the park tidy for the next guests on your site.

Is the Bermagui park dog-friendly?

Bermagui Caravan Park is dog-friendly all year round on all sites and selected tiny homes. Up to 2 dogs can be booked online, by phone, or in park.

Can you see whales from Bermagui?

The Sapphire Coast is a great place to spot migrating whales. On land, Blue Pool Bermagui lookout is a great place to keep an eye out or enjoy one of the many whale-watching cruises in the area if you prefer to get out amongst it!

How far is Bermagui from Sydney?

Bermagui is a five-hour drive heading south from Sydney.


Where is Bermagui NSW?

Bermagui is a coastal town on the NSW south coast approximately a five-hour drive from Sydney and 3hr 30mins from Canberra.


What is there to do in Bermagui?

There are plenty of natural wonders in and around Bermagui, from the Blue Pool and Mimosa Rocks National Park to Camel Rock and the tranquil Bermagui River and Wallaga Lake. Bermagui is well-known for its impressive fishing opportunities and wide range of dining options.

What park amenities does Reflections Bermagui have?

Reflections Bermagui is well-kitted out for campers with a range of facilities and amenities, like 2 camp kitchens, amenity blocks, laundry, dog wash and playground.

Can I charge my Electric Vehicle at Reflections Bermagui?

Yes, Reflections Bermagui has a designated EV Charging Station and park guests are welcome to use it.

Charging an electric vehicle on campsites or at any of roofed accommodation is not permitted.
